The art of clowning has existed for thousands of years. A pygmy clown performed as a jester in the court of Pharaoh Dadkeri-Assi during Egypt's Fifth Dynasty regarding 2500 B.C. Court jesters have done in China considering that 1818 B.C. Throughout background most societies have had clowns. When Cortez dominated the Aztec Nation in 1520 A.D.

One of the most popular of the European court jesters was Nasir Ed Racket (https://anotepad.com/notes/bq7qj49w). One day the king glimpsed himself and a mirror, and distressed at how old he looked, began weeping.




When the king quit crying, every person else quit sobbing too, except Nasir Ed Hullabaloo. When the king asked Nasir why he was still crying, he responded, "Sire, you took a look at yourself in the mirror however, for a minute and you wept. I have to take a look at you regularly." The Commedia del Arte started in Italy in the 16th century and quickly controlled European movie theater.

It consisted of lots of comic characters split right into masters and servants. There were 3 sorts of comic slaves: the First Zany, the Second Zany, and the Fantesca. The First Zany was a male servant that was a clever rogue commonly plotting against the masters. The 2nd Zany was a silly male slave that was caught up in the First Zany's schemes and typically the sufferer of his pranks.


The background of clowning is a history of creativity, evolution, and adjustment. Harlequin began as a Second Zany, the victim of Brighella. Performers representing Harlequin gradually made him a smarter personality till he ultimately appropriated Brighella's position. In English Pantomime, a style of theater based on the Commedia del Arte, John Rich completed the evolution of Harlequin elevating it to starring placement.

Philip Astley produced what is considered the initial circus in England in 1768. He additionally created the initial circus clown act called Billy Buttons, or the Tailor's Experience To Brentford. His act was based on a prominent story of a tailor, an inept equestrian, trying to ride an equine to Brentford to elect in a political election.


He had excellent trouble installing the horse properly, and then when he finally succeeded the equine began off so fast that he dropped off. As the circus expanded and Astley worked with various other clowns, he needed them to find out Billy Buttons - Dallas corporate events Dallas. It quickly ended up being a traditional part of every circus for the following century
